OpenERP Server Installation On Fedora 11
This article will show you how to set up OpenERP on Fedora 11. Open ERP (formerly named Tiny ERP) is the leader open-source ERP/CRM system written mostly in Python and initiated in Belgium. It offers a three-tier web architecture, ease of use and flexibility.
Grab the Super User Access:
su root
Enable EPEL Repo:
su -c 'rpm -Uvh http://download.fedora.redhat.com/pub/epel/5/i386/epel-release-5-3.noarch.rpm'
yum update
Update the Installation Repository.
Start Installing Packages.
yum install postgresql-server
yum install postgresql
If the default database instance is not created then you need to init the db.
su root
su postgres
initdb /var/lib/pgsql/data
su postgres
psql -l
yum install python-psycopg2
yum install python-lxml
yum install PyXML
yum install python-setuptools-devel
easy_install egenix-mx-base
yum install libxslt-python
yum install pytz
yum install python-matplotlib
----------- Grab the OpenERP Server and Client -------------
wget http://openerp.com/download/stable/source/openerp-server-5.0.1-0.tar.gz
tar -xvf openerp-server-5.0.1-0.tar.gz
cd openerp-server-5.0.1-0
python openerp-server.py
wget http://openerp.com/download/stable/source/openerp-client-5.0.1-0.tar.gz
tar -xvf openerp-client-5.0.1-0
cd openerp-client-5.0.1-0
python openerp-client.py
